The 2006 International
Taekwon-Do Instructor Course in China was a great success with
a firm belief and the efforts of China International Taekwon-Do
Federation (China ITF), and an iron will of Grandmaster Rhee Ki
Ha.
Grandmaster Rhee Ki Ha is one of the pioneers of Taekwon-Do and
one of the founding members of the original International Taekwon-Do
Federation (ITF). Grandmaster Rhee Ki Ha was invited by China
ITF to conduct Taekwon-Do Seminar in Beijing, China on May 20
and 21, 2006. Hundreds of TAEKWON-DO lovers attended this event
from all over the country. Grandmaster Rhee Ki Ha and members
of his entourage received a special reception at airport as national
VIP and the warmest hospitality during their stay in China.
The course was separated to senior class for black belts and junior
class for all belts. Both classes had substantial numbers of participant.
Both practitioner and instructor were conscientious during the
seminar. Grandmaster Rhee Ki Ha reveal the true significance of
ITF with his consummate ITF skills to the students even though
he cannot speak Chinese. During the senior class for black belts,
Grandmaster Rhee Ki Ha personally guided every black-belt student
and corrected their mistakes, which benefited the entire practitioners.
